abstract="We describe three cases of fresh-water drowning that were complicated by disseminated intravascular coagulation. Close observation for clinical bleeding, laboratory investigation of the coagulation system, and therapy for disseminated intravascular coagulation, when appropriate, seem indicated in patients hospitalized after fresh-water immersion.<p /><p>Language: en</p>",
